Total Time: 30 minsServings: 24Calories: 160 per serving1.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Line 2 cookie sheets with aluminum foil.
2. Melt butter in a large saucepan. Remove from heat and mix in oats, sugar, flour, corn syrup, milk, vanilla, and salt until well combined. Drop by level teaspoonfuls 3 inches apart onto the prepared cookie sheets. Spread cookies out thin with a rubber spatula.
3.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, 5 to 7 minutes. Cool on the cookie sheets.
4. Meanwhile, place chocolate chips in the top of a double boiler over simmering water. Stir frequently, scraping down the sides with a rubber spatula to avoid scorching, until chocolate is melted and smooth, about 5 minutes.
